#71234c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71234c is composed of 44.3% red, 13.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 328.5 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 29%. #71234c color hex could be obtained by blending #e24698 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#71234c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71234c has RGB values of R:113, G:35,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.33,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7414604.

Shades and Tints of #71234c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080305 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#71234c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f454a is the less saturated color, while #93014e is the most saturated one.
